summaryrefslogtreecommitdiff
path: root/src/compiler/scala/tools/nsc/transform/OverridingPairs.scala
diff options
context:
space:
mode:
Diffstat (limited to 'src/compiler/scala/tools/nsc/transform/OverridingPairs.scala')
-rw-r--r--src/compiler/scala/tools/nsc/transform/OverridingPairs.scala3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/compiler/scala/tools/nsc/transform/OverridingPairs.scala b/src/compiler/scala/tools/nsc/transform/OverridingPairs.scala
index 6aef9fc691..fcf9da53e0 100644
--- a/src/compiler/scala/tools/nsc/transform/OverridingPairs.scala
+++ b/src/compiler/scala/tools/nsc/transform/OverridingPairs.scala
@@ -103,6 +103,7 @@ abstract class OverridingPairs {
var overriding: Symbol = _
var overridden: Symbol = _
+ //@M: note that next is called once during object initialisation
def hasNext: boolean = curEntry ne null
def next: unit =
@@ -131,6 +132,6 @@ abstract class OverridingPairs {
}
}
- next
+ next //@M: ATTN! this method gets called during construction!
}
}